What skills and experience we're looking for

We are seeking to appoint an excellent teacher to join our vibrant and friendly maths department. Our philosophy is to play to the strengths in our team: we have a fully resourced KS3-5 curriculum, but staff are encouraged to teach in the way which works best for them and there is no requirement to use the centrally-planned resources or to teach topics in a particular way.

Experimenting with teaching techniques and ideas is encouraged with a number of members of the department being involved in research. We look forward to welcoming new team members and the ideas they bring to the department.

What the school offers its staff

As a department, we have a strong track record of supporting and developing our teaching staff. Our programme includes:

  • A place on the Developing Outstanding Teaching programme which features four days looking at high-level skills and strategies for the classroom including a focus on how coaching and mentoring can develop other colleagues and lead change in the department.
  • The opportunity to participate in or lead some of the many excellent Maths Hub work groups which the Cambridge Maths Hub offers.
  • The possibility to be supported in undertaking a Masters Degree in Education.
  • For staff interested in supporting new teachers, we can offer access to development opportunities through our teaching school alliance (camteach.org.uk), including those to develop as a ITT or ECT mentor.


Further details about the role

We are seeking to appoint an excellent teacher to lead our team of sixth form maths teachers. Our philosophy is to play to the strengths of our team so, while we have a fully resourced KS3-5 curriculum, staff are encouraged to teach in the way that works best for them and there is no requirement to use the centrally planned resources or to teach topics in a particular way. Comberton Village College is an AMSP Partner school and an AMSP Area Coordinator is based at our college.

This is an exciting time to join our maths department. The Cam Academy Trust are proud to be the base for the Cambridge Maths Hub and as such we enable other schools and colleges to access locally-tailored and high quality support to develop the teaching and learning of mathematics within their own organisations. Many members of the Comberton maths department have gone on to lead work groups for or be seconded to the Maths Hub. As well as the Maths Hub, the department is involved with various NCETM projects and has recently become involved with the Teaching for Mastery project, with two Secondary Mastery Specialists based at the school. We are proud to be a teaching school and many members of the department are involved with initial teacher education and supporting others with their continuing professional development. Experimenting with teaching techniques and ideas is encouraged with various members of the department being involved in research.
